Programs Offered at Denver Technical College



One of the key features that set Denver Technical College apart is its diverse array of programs. The college offers both certificate and degree programs in various technical fields, enabling students to choose the path that best aligns with their career goals.

Technical Programs



Denver Technical College provides several technical programs that focus on hands-on training and real-world applications. Some of the popular programs include:

1. Automotive Technology: This program covers everything from basic automotive systems to advanced diagnostics and repair techniques.
2. Information Technology: Students learn essential skills in networking, cybersecurity, and software development.
3. Culinary Arts: This program offers training in cooking techniques, food safety, and restaurant management.
4. Healthcare Programs: Denver Technical College offers courses in nursing, medical assisting, and pharmacy technology.
5. Construction Management: Students gain knowledge in project management, construction safety, and building codes.

Is Denver Technical College accredited?

Yes, Denver Technical College is accredited by the Accrediting Commission of Career Schools and Colleges (ACCSC), ensuring that its programs meet certain educational standards.

What are the admission requirements for Denver Technical College?

Admission requirements typically include a high school diploma or equivalent, completion of an application form, and possibly an interview or placement test depending on the program.
